Notification
The Banks Ram-Air Filter
comes pre-oiled and no oiling
is necessary for the initial
installation. Service the filter as
specified in this Section of the
manual.
1.
Service Banks Ram Air Filter every
50-100,000 miles on street-driven
applications. Service more often in
off-road or heavy-dust conditions. If an
air-filter restriction gauge is installed,
then clean the element when the
air-filter restriction gauge enters the
restrictive red zone. See Figure 16.
2.
Use Banks Ram Air Filter cleaning
system (part # 90094), available from
Gale Banks Engineering to service
the Air Filter. Follow the instructions
included with the cleaning system
to clean and re-oil your Banks Ram
Air Filter. No gasoline cleaning, No
steam cleaning, No caustic cleaning
solutions, No strong detergents, No
high pressure car wash, No parts
cleaning solvents. Any of these No’s
can cause harm to the cotton filter
media plus SHRINK and HARDEN the
rubber end caps.
CAUTION! Extremely fine dust from
agriculture or off-road use will pull
the oil from the element. Frequent
re-oiling of the element’s clean
side might be required. Completely
service when practicable. Service
only with Banks Ram-Air-filter
cleaner and Banks Ram-Air-filter oil.
